[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#1027278: marked as done (gcc-12: change multiarch from loongarch64-linux-gnu to loongarch64-linux-gnuf64)



Your message dated Sat, 31 Dec 2022 12:08:21 +0000
with message-id <E1pBaez-00FCco-Ft@fasolo.debian.org>
and subject line Bug#1027278: fixed in gcc-12 12.2.0-12
has caused the Debian Bug report #1027278,
regarding gcc-12: change multiarch from loongarch64-linux-gnu to loongarch64-linux-gnuf64
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act owner@bugs.debian.org
immediately.)


-- 
1027278: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1027278
Debian Bug Tracking System
Contact owner@bugs.debian.org with problems
--- Begin Message ---
Package: gcc-12
Version: 12.2.0-11
Severity: wishlist
Tags: patch
User: debian-devel@lists.debian.org
Usertags: loongarch64

Dear gcc maintainers,

According to LoongArch manual: https://loongson.github.io/LoongArch-Documentation/LoongArch-toolchain-conventions-EN.html LoongArch need to change multiarch from loongarch64-linux-gnu to loongarch64-linux-gnuf64.

Please consider applying the attached patch and we could continue to discuss.

Thanks
Dandan Zhang

diff --git a/debian/patches/gcc-multilib-multiarch.diff b/debian/patches/gcc-multilib-multiarch.diff
index 128d6008a..bd05f757b 100644
--- a/debian/patches/gcc-multilib-multiarch.diff
+++ b/debian/patches/gcc-multilib-multiarch.diff
@@ -119,7 +119,7 @@
      # Only define MULTIARCH_DIRNAME when multiarch is enabled,
      # or it would always introduce ${target} into the search path.
 -    MULTIARCH_DIRNAME = $(LA_MULTIARCH_TRIPLET)
-+    MULTIARCH_DIRNAME = $(call if_multiarch,loongarch64-linux-gnu)
++    MULTIARCH_DIRNAME = $(call if_multiarch,loongarch64-linux-gnuf64)
  endif
  
  # Don't define MULTILIB_OSDIRNAMES if multilib is disabled.
@@ -128,7 +128,7 @@
      MULTILIB_OSDIRNAMES = \
 -      mabi.lp64d=../lib64$\
 -      $(call if_multiarch,:loongarch64-linux-gnuf64)
-+      mabi.lp64d=../lib$(call if_multiarch,:loongarch64-linux-gnu)
++      mabi.lp64d=../lib$(call if_multiarch,:loongarch64-linux-gnuf64)
  
      MULTILIB_OSDIRNAMES += \
 -      mabi.lp64f=../lib64/f32$\

--- End Message ---
--- Begin Message ---
Source: gcc-12
Source-Version: 12.2.0-12
Done: Matthias Klose <doko@debian.org>

We believe that the bug you reported is fixed in the latest version of
gcc-12,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 1027278@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Matthias Klose <doko@debian.org> (supplier of updated gcc-12 package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256

Format: 1.8
Date: Sat, 31 Dec 2022 12:30:21 +0100
Source: gcc-12
Architecture: source
Version: 12.2.0-12
Distribution: unstable
Urgency: medium
Maintainer: Debian GCC Maintainers <debian-gcc@lists.debian.org>
Changed-By: Matthias Klose <doko@debian.org>
Closes: 1027278
Changes:
 gcc-12 (12.2.0-12) unstable; urgency=medium
 .
   * Update to git 20221231 from the gcc-12 branch.
     - Fix PR fortran/108131.
   * Update multiarch patch for looongson. Closes: #1027278.
Checksums-Sha1:
 53708199c6afd54d671048003f07ee10f282e76f 27505 gcc-12_12.2.0-12.dsc
 182842e1b36c9d0ca7f2bc1e4fadafece7d54952 1662008 gcc-12_12.2.0-12.debian.tar.xz
 2e287b4c113a8d5dae9f962da218a1f4ef9005ac 10164 gcc-12_12.2.0-12_source.buildinfo
Checksums-Sha256:
 1de510b016cd1fbcd106d61abfb69414d86d5250f4dd625a7f86624de87087af 27505 gcc-12_12.2.0-12.dsc
 16d4697b5e1ccf17012e47a4834c831341f9e4fb3c12a541c5a530d8beb9fb42 1662008 gcc-12_12.2.0-12.debian.tar.xz
 9ec62a6df0a0198da61495f5a85eff3677cb843ef750b898fd52d57cedb8a745 10164 gcc-12_12.2.0-12_source.buildinfo
Files:
 45f1ce14053c2e5f6d0339ae4906e723 27505 devel optional gcc-12_12.2.0-12.dsc
 5fb2fc40d74263bc9addd2e79a1a2bb8 1662008 devel optional gcc-12_12.2.0-12.debian.tar.xz
 7fa7b966871a25ee233686c6c7970bf2 10164 devel optional gcc-12_12.2.0-12_source.buildinfo

-----BEGIN PGP SIGNATURE-----

iQJEBAEBCAAuFiEE1WVxuIqLuvFAv2PWvX6qYHePpvUFAmOwHWEQHGRva29AZGVi
aWFuLm9yZwAKCRC9fqpgd4+m9bE7D/44wyu1MqBpIwE6YmCm4W/sYi1SIyIVRHyA
czpWRjd2Ibjj44t/R+RF0zUsntpgO2gW/S+KwWGkmI0e+yOYAj+QKBtTpNPPHwk1
N7PgPvCX7AZzLSvfqHEpYhASQ7S3bdhYsyBwpxZWU8XljDvNxlvkU1ZfRsK06T78
BXlZaUD8IHkHtStO/wThDUogoGVFYeKJQb9DazR90TPNX3SqpLb2tKWlHlvFdKPC
TVXLAAo6ukApwGh+hdNupHvHPnIIjh4KDPlTHvR+O3mCtItMhs6WN4bwUNC7ZosB
CbqTmPCXjVlzwE4P7Os7s03kodn7gVsFRNthfiMUnf5j4NHkL4zvRQ8uc0xFnBL6
D+NTt/NZL9JDLhfAM2HroGdIZ5yri92FN4ouWs8fkdVw9n6Y/PTVmx4YpkkG8LYw
Klebp9nCb98wP7r7HD0aND0VIeTAV26HpwR3m9JPJfxJtkon2czYtUVo+uiuRBg2
3jn9Hk0d4aZy5aHOMzLYFBbFS2D0X8Antib727rYIvMf2T8JfJWofs1+Lvzpr8gJ
EQPfNhEKSXZRl7JlKZI8Z2ldNy0KUJIh36y4XNag8G7HbwRVEbUPSoJ5OUA+NMA4
dXUZEZSg2R4Po7Us5zClaNNAQos8EWgdUPgXLilrsucAG5odtBoCyvy7fV7rIPf1
79W6sFgSyQ==
=GQDp
-----END PGP SIGNATURE-----

--- End Message ---

Reply to: